Kollmorgen S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F Servo Drive Gains Traction in Precision Motion Control Applications
The Kollmorgen S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F, a high-performance servo drive, is increasingly being adopted across industries requiring ultra-precise motion control, including robotics, semiconductor manufacturing, and advanced packaging systems. Known for its compact design and exceptional torque density, the drive is emerging as a critical enabler of automation in sectors where accuracy, reliability, and energy efficiency are paramount.
Engineered to integrate seamlessly with Kollmorgen’s AKD series servo motors, the S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F combines advanced control algorithms with a modular architecture, allowing customization for complex motion profiles. Its ability to deliver high dynamic response and smooth torque control makes it ideal for applications such as precision assembly lines, CNC machining, and medical device manufacturing. Users highlight its compatibility with EtherCAT and other industrial communication protocols, which simplifies integration into smart factory ecosystems and IoT-enabled workflows.
In semiconductor fabrication facilities, the drive’s sub-micron positioning accuracy ensures consistent performance in wafer handling and photolithography processes. Similarly, in automated logistics, the S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F powers robotic sortation systems that demand rapid acceleration and deceleration without compromising load stability. Its rugged construction and resistance to electrical noise further enhance reliability in environments with stringent elect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) requirements.
A key differentiator is the drive’s integrated safety features, including Safe Torque Off (STO) and Safe Stop functionalities, which align with global machine safety standards. These capabilities are critical for collaborative robotics and human-machine interaction scenarios, where operational safety cannot be compromised.
Kollmorgen has also emphasized the S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F’s role in energy efficiency. By optimizing power usage during partial-load operations and reducing heat dissipation, the drive supports sustainability goals while lowering total cost of ownership—a factor driving adoption in energy-conscious industries.
Recent deployments include high-speed packaging lines for consumer goods and precision-guided surgical robots, where the drive’s ability to maintain performance under variable loads has reduced downtime and improved throughput. Additionally, its user-friendly tuning software enables rapid commissioning, minimizing production interruptions during system upgrades.
To support broader adoption, Kollmorgen has expanded its technical resources, offering application-specific configuration guides and remote diagnostics tailored to the S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F. These efforts aim to empower engineers to maximize the drive’s capabilities in diverse automation scenarios.
As industries accelerate investments in smart manufacturing and Industry 4.0 initiatives, demand for precision motion control solutions like the SAM-DA-400-07B-P4N-F is projected to grow. Market analysts underscore its potential to bridge gaps between legacy systems and next-generation automation, positioning Kollmorgen as a key player in the evolving landscape of intelligent, connected industrial technologies.
